Understanding Diabetes
Diabetes is characterised by high blood sugar levels, which can lead to various health issues if not managed properly. There are two main types of diabetes:
- Type 1 Diabetes: An autoimmune condition where the body does not produce insulin, requiring lifelong insulin therapy.
- Type 2 Diabetes: A condition where the body does not use insulin properly or does not produce enough, often managed with lifestyle changes, medication, or insulin therapy.
Key Aspects of Diabetes Care
Managing diabetes involves several key components:
- Blood Sugar Monitoring: Regular monitoring of blood sugar levels is essential to ensure they remain within the target range. This helps to prevent both hypoglycaemia (low blood sugar) and hyperglycaemia (high blood sugar).
- Medication Management: Adhering to prescribed medications, including insulin or oral hypoglycaemics, is crucial for effective diabetes management. Proper medication management helps control blood sugar levels and prevent complications.
- Diet and Nutrition: A balanced diet is vital for managing diabetes. This includes monitoring carbohydrate intake, eating regular meals, and choosing foods that help stabilise blood sugar levels.
- Physical Activity: Regular exercise is beneficial for managing diabetes as it helps regulate blood sugar levels, improve insulin sensitivity, and support overall health.
- Foot Care: Individuals with diabetes need to take special care of their feet to prevent complications such as infections and ulcers, which can arise due to reduced circulation and sensation.
- Health Monitoring: Regular check-ups with healthcare professionals are important to monitor diabetes-related health metrics and address any issues promptly.
